在Oracle数据库中,可以使用以下方法来查看建表语句:
-
使用
DESCRIBE
命令:DESCRIBE 表名;
例如,要查看名为
employees
的表的建表语句,可以执行:DESCRIBE employees;
这将显示表的结构,包括列名、数据类型和是否允许为空等信息。
-
使用
SHOW CREATE TABLE
命令:SHOW CREATE TABLE 表名;
例如,要查看名为
employees
的表的建表语句,可以执行:SHOW CREATE TABLE employees;
这将显示创建表的完整语句,包括表名、列定义、约束等。
-
从
USER_TAB_COLUMNS
视图中查询:SELECT column_name, data_type, constraints FROM user_tab_columns WHERE table_name = '表名';
例如,要查看名为
employees
的表的建表语句,可以执行:SELECT column_name, data_type, constraints FROM user_tab_columns WHERE table_name = 'employees';
这将显示表的所有列及其数据类型和约束信息。
请注意,这些方法仅适用于查看已经存在的表的建表语句。如果要查看创建新表的建表语句,您需要查询USER_TAB_COLUMNS
视图并结合CREATE TABLE
语句来手动构建。